The Foundation of Korean Massage: Balance and Harmony

Central to Korean massage is the concept of balance and harmony within the body. Practitioners believe that when energy flows smoothly through the body’s meridians (energy pathways), health and vitality are restored. Techniques such as acupressure, where specific points on the body are pressed to release tension and improve circulation, play a crucial role in achieving this balance.

Exploring Korean Massage Techniques: From Patting to Pressing

Korean massage techniques encompass a wide range of methods, each serving a unique purpose in promoting relaxation and rejuvenation. One distinctive technique is “patting,” where the therapist gently taps rhythmically on the body. This rhythmic tapping helps to stimulate blood circulation and awaken the body’s natural healing abilities.
